How they compare
Serbia currently reports 23.42 deaths against 21.03 deaths in Finland, a difference of 2.39 deaths.
That makes Serbia's figure about 1.1 times Finland's.
The two have swapped places 10 times across 22 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Serbia ahead.
Finland ranks 117th and Serbia ranks 114th of 194 countries.
Finland has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Finland | Serbia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 45.96 deaths | 40.64 deaths | 5.31 deaths | Finland |
| 2010s | 31.75 deaths | 28.83 deaths | 2.92 deaths | Finland |
| 2020s | 25.2 deaths | 18.89 deaths | 6.31 deaths | Finland |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
